SolarReserve to build 150MW solar thermal project in South Australia

The SMH reports that SolarReserve will be building a 150MW solar thermal power plant in South Australia, following on the commissioning of the world's largest battery storage facility by Tesla in the state and in parallel with Zen Energy’s 1GW solar / storage project - South Australia planning to build the world’s largest thermal solar plant.
Following the success of the world’s largest battery, South Australia is aiming to build the world’s largest thermal solar plant. SolarReserve’s $650 million, 150 megawatt Aurora solar thermal plant has received state development approval. Construction of the facility will begin this year.
